This was a highlight of our visit to Concord. The Paul Revere gallery was wonderful, but the literary artifacts were amazing. The museum was very careful with the number of people booked in advance and sanitizing. I felt very safe there.

Good time-killer if you are traveling through the Concord area. Took an hour maximum to get through everything. Notable artifacts overshadow the less significant ones. Many areas of the building were under construction and off limits. Would not go out of my way to go here but if I was passing through Concord, it would not be a bad stop.
